About The Role:
As a Senior QA Engineer, you will lead initiatives to assess, develop and enhance product and supplier quality. Utilizing your strong analytical, technical and collaborative skills, along with your experience in quality assurance for complex instruments, you will build robust quality strategies, foster strong supplier relationships and ensure the highest quality standards are met across products and supply chain.
What You'Ll Be Doing:
New Product Transfer
- Collaborate with R&D and Engineering to ensure product meets quality, manufacturability and reliability requirements from pilot build through production
- Provide quality oversight and guidance to internal teams and contract manufacturers throughout new product introduction and production transfer
- Participate in build readiness reviews, risk assessments, and issue resolution to ensure a seamless transition from pilot to full production
Supplier Quality Management
- Partner with contract manufacturers and key suppliers to ensure product and process quality meet requirements
- Assess, develop, and continuously improve supplier quality systems, driving alignment to company expectations and quality standards (ISO 9001/13485)
- Conduct supplier audits, process reviews and performance monitoring using quality metrics and KPIs
- Lead root cause analysis and corrective action implementation for supplier-related issues, including SCAR management
- Build strong collaborative relationships with suppliers to foster a culture of quality ownership and continuous improvement
Manage Quality Operations
- Lead investigation and resolution of nonconformances, deviations and manufacturing issues reported from internal production teams
- Partner with contract manufacturers and suppliers on failure analysis and corrective actions
- Support customer complaint investigations related to instruments, ensuring timely containment, root cause identification and CAPA implementation
- Drive ongoing quality improvements in instrument assembly processes both in-house and at suppliers
Continuous Improvement
- Support development and continuous enhancement of quality procedures, documentation and control processes
- Track and analyze key quality metrics to identify trends and drive preventive actions
- Support internal and external audits, qualification and regulatory compliance efforts
- Lead and participate in cross-functional quality improvement projects to strengthen product reliability and process robustness
Minimum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ering (or equivalent)
- Demonstrable experience in complex instrumentation or electro-mechanical system manufacturing within the Life Sciences or Medical Device industry
- Strong technical understanding of precision assemblies, motion systems (X-Y stage), instrument fixtures and testing tools
- Proven experience working with contract manufacturers and managing supplier quality and performance including participation in NPI cycles
- Experience in supplier development or Supplier Management/Vendor quality system enhancement
- Understanding of ISO 9001 and/or ISO 13485 quality management system requirements
- Knowledge of CAPA, nonconformance, deviation and SCAR management
- Strong problem-solving and analytical skills, with a track record of driving quality and process improvements
- Excellent communication and collaboration skills with cross-functional partners
Preferred Skills And/Or Experience:
- Professional quality certification such as CQE, CQA or Six Sigma Green/Black Belt
- Knowledge of software and firmware integration testing in complex instruments
- Proficiency with data analysis and quality tools (e.g. 8D, FMEA, SPC, Pareto)
